- Understanding Loan Settlement: This approach involves negotiating a reduced lump-sum payment to settle your outstanding debt. It's crucial to remember that this can affect your credit score, so it's a decision that should be made with careful consideration.
- Formulating a Solid Negotiation Strategy: Before approaching your creditors, collect all relevant documents such as loan agreements and recent payment history. Research average settlement amounts for similar debts to have a realistic expectation.
- Seeking Expert Guidance: A credit counselor or debt settlement professional can provide valuable advice and help you navigate the nuances of loan settlement negotiations. They can also negotiate on your behalf with creditors to achieve a favorable outcome.

Loan consolidation involves aggregating several existing debts into a single new loan with a favorable interest rate and term. This can help you streamline your budgeting by reducing the quantity of payments you need to make each month, freeing up resources for other aspirations.
It's important to carefully assess your options before deciding if loan consolidation is right for you. There are various types of consolidation loans available, and each offers its own advantages. Consult with a financial advisor to identify the best strategy for your unique situation.
